Ode To the Sea
Are there words to tell,
The beauty that you hold within?
The mystery upon every swell,.
Where God had life begin.
Feeding multitudes with your bounty;
Man existence depends on you.
So giving of your endless plenty;
Beneath your waves of blue.
The mysteries you hold
Are to man a constantly calling.
Will your story ever be told;
Or are our methods too appalling?
You deserve our endless gratitude,
For all you have provided.
You play a beautiful etude,
Of which God’s elegant hand has guided.
